About the Role:

Education Coordinators are vital in ensuring that caregivers receive the necessary training and education to perform their jobs effectively and to maintain compliance with regulatory standards.

What Youll Do:

  • Create and update curriculum materials presentations and training manuals to ensure content remains relevant and up to date with best practices.
  • Ensure all training programs meet regulatory requirements and standards.
  • Deliver training sessions to ensure staff members receive necessary education.
  • Partner with department leads to identify areas where staff members require additional training or professional development and develop plan to address the needs.
  • Monitor performance of trainees and provide feedback and support to ensure success.
  • Develop and administer orientation.
  • Provide general administrative support including schedules. Distribute and collect monthly safety paperwork and ensure completion.

Qualification(s):

  • Education: High school diploma or equivalent

Preferred Qualification(s):

  • Minimum ONE year experience in sterile processing highly preferred.

  • Certified Registered Central Service (CRCST) highly preferred.
